Dryden, On vs Grand Junction, Colorado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Dryden, On, Canada and Grand Junction, Colorado, Usa is approximately 1,721 km or 1,070 mi.
  • To reach Dryden, On in this distance one would set out from Grand Junction, Colorado bearing 41.1°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Dryden, On bearing 52.2° or NE .
  • Dryden, On has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Grand Junction, Colorado has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
  • Dryden, On is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Grand Junction, Colorado is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 9.6 °C (17.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.9 °C (12.4°F) more in Dryden, On.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 466.1 mm (18.4 in) more which is equivalent to 466.1 l/m² (11.44 US gal/ft²) or 4,661,000 l/ha (498,292 US gal/ac) more. About 3 1/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.7° lower in Dryden, On than in Grand Junction, Colorado.
